When the story of Jesus’ birth is read, we often read from the book of Luke. Yet, today I was led to read the brief synopsis captured in Matthew.

In these verses (Matthew 1:18-23), Joseph found himself in a predicament. He thought he only had two choices in dealing with his quandary; to quietly break his engagement with Mary or (as it was the Jewish custom to do) have her stoned to death. You can tell that Joseph was torn because he didn’t act hastily, he decided to sleep on it. While sleeping, Joseph received clarification and confirmation on a third option…the best option…God’s will. Joseph chose God’s will and prophecy was fulfilled.
